以太坊快速确认规则:13 秒充值如何终结终局性等待
· 阅读需 11 分钟
目前,以太坊交易达到最终确认(finality)大约需要 13 分钟。在这 13 分钟内,交易所拒绝入账充值,跨链桥将资金锁定在待定状态,而 Layer-2 Rollup 在向 L1 结算前也会焦急地等待。与此同时,Solana 的确认时间不到一秒,Base 用户几乎察觉不到延迟。对于一个仍处理着绝大部分 DeFi 价值的生态系统来说,以太坊极其缓慢的最终确认已成为其最明显的竞争弱点。
这可能即将发生改变——而且无需进行任何硬分叉。
快速确认规则(FCR)的实际运作机制
快速确认规则(FCR)是一项新的共识客户端功能,它允许服务在仅经过一个插槽(slot)——大约 13 秒——后就将以太坊区块视为安全确认,而无需等待两个完整周期(epoch,共 64 个插槽,约 13 分钟)来达到经济最终性。
FCR 背后的核心思路出奇地简单:它不再单纯计算区块数量,而是实时评估验证者见证(validator attestations)。在正常的网络条件下,如果绝大多数验证者在某个区块的插槽内对其进行了见证,那么该区块被撤销的概率实际上降至零。
以下是其运作机制:
- 提议区块(以太坊每 12 秒产生一个插槽)。
- 验证者进行见证。共识层在同一插槽内收集这些见证。
- FCR 评估累积的见证权重是否超过安全阈值——具体而言,是否至少有 75% 的质押 ETH 总量支持该区块。
- 如果达到阈值,该区块将通过现有的 JSON-RPC
safe区块标签被标记为“安全(safe)”。无需新的 API 端点。 - 如果未达到阈值(网络分区、高延迟或对抗性条件),FCR 会平稳地回退到标准最终性确认——系统绝不会做出不安全的确认。
结果是,在正常条件下,确认延迟缩减了 98%,从大约 13 分钟降至 13 秒。
为什么这比听起来更重要
原始速度的提升是巨大的,但真正的意义在于它为整个生态系统带来的可能性。